The eleventh ExpertTalks session was led by Paramjeet Chawla, Program Manager at WRI India, focusing on data sources and data analysis techniques. This session was designed to equip the Jalandhar Eco City Regions Fellows with essential skills for sourcing and analyzing data, key to informed decision-making for sustainable urban development.

Key highlights of the session included:

  • National and Global Data Sources: Fellows were introduced to essential data sources like the Census India website, National Family Health Survey, and district handbooks for comprehensive data collection.
  • Data Visualization Techniques: The session emphasized the importance of using visualization techniques to make sense of complex data.
  • Aligning Data with SDGs: A discussion on the relevance of data indices to the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s), with examples from Jalandhar, highlighted how data-driven approaches can inform sustainable urban policies.

Paramjeet emphasized the distinction between data and information, stressing the importance of clear research objectives and aligning them with national and global data sources to drive effective, evidence-based decision-making.
